Connect Mac Mini (new 2014) to TV/Monitor

Yesterday I received my new 2.6GHz Mac Mini that is replacing a 2010 Mac Mini. The old Mac Mini was connected to a Philips 32" smart TV that I use as a monitor, via a Mini Display port--VGA adaptor. It worked fine. I tried to connect the new Mac Mini using the same adaptor and cable using one of the Thunderbolt ports. When I start the new Mac Mini, the Apple Icon shows up and the bar shows that the OS is loading. However, when the bar is about one third completed, the monitor screen starts to blink and the Mac Mini restarts. This process then repeats itself. The Mac Mini never finishes booting up. It doesn't matter which of the two Thunderbolt ports is used to connect to the TV/monitor. The same thing keeps happening. When I reconnect to the old Mac Mini, everything is fine. I am not concerned about using the TV speakers as I have external computer speakers for sound. I am stumped as to what I can do. Any help would be greatly appreciated.
